Yitro "His Excellence"
Ex 18:1 - 20:26 , Is 6:1 - 7:6,9:6-7
Reader 1 (Evening Portion)
Exo 18:1 When Yitro, the priest of Midyan, Moshe's father in law, heard of all that Elohim had done for Moshe, and for Yisra'el His people, and that YHWH had brought Yisra'el out of Egypt;
Exo 18:2 Then Yitro, Moshe's father in law, took Tzipporah, Moshe' wife, after he had sent her back,
Exo 18:3 And her two sons; of which the name of the one was Gershom; for he said, I have been a stranger in a strange land:
Exo 18:4 And the name of the other was Eli'ezer; for the Elohim of my father, said he, was my help, and delivered me from the sword of Par'oh:
Exo 18:5 And Yitro, Moshe's father in law, came with his sons and his wife unto Moshe into the wilderness, where he encamped at the mount of Elohim:
Exo 18:6 And he said unto Moshe, I, your father in law Yitro am come unto you, and your wife, and her two sons with her.
(Morning Portion)
Exo 18:7 And Moshe went out to meet his father in law, and did obeisance, and kissed him; and they asked each other of their welfare; and they came into the tent.
Exo 18:8 And Moshe told his father in law all that YHWH had done unto Par'oh and to the Egyptians for Yisra'el's sake, and all the travail that had come upon them by the way, and how YHWH delivered them.
Exo 18:9 And Yitro rejoiced for all the goodness which YHWH had done to Yisra'el, whom he had delivered out of the hand of the Egyptians.
Exo 18:10 And Yitro said, Blessed be YHWH, who has delivered you out of the hand of the Egyptians, and out of the hand of Par'oh, who has delivered the people from under the hand of the Egyptians.
Exo 18:11 Now I know that YHWH is greater than all elohim: for in the thing wherein they dealt proudly he was above them.
Exo 18:12 And Yitro, Moshe's father in law, took a burnt offering and sacrifices for Elohim: and Aharon came, and all the elders of Yisra'el, to eat bread with Moshe's father in law before Elohim.
Reader 2 (Evening Portion)
Exo 18:13 And it came to pass on the morrow, that Moshe sat to judge the people: and the people stood by Moshe from the morning unto the evening.
Exo 18:14 And when Moshe's father in law saw all that he did to the people, he said, What is this thing that you do to the people? why sit you yourself alone, and all the people stand by you from morning unto even?
Exo 18:15 And Moshe said unto his father in law, Because the people come unto me to enquire of Elohim:
Exo 18:16 When they have a matter, they come unto me; and I judge between one and another, and I do make them know the statutes of Elohim, and his laws.
(Morning Portion)
Exo 18:17 And Moshe's father in law said unto him, The thing that you do is not good.
Exo 18:18 You will surely wear away, both you, and this people that is with you: for this thing is too heavy for you; you are not able to perform it yourself alone.
Exo 18:19 Hearken now unto my voice, I will give you counsel, and Elohim shall be with you: Be you for the people to Elohim-ward, that you may bring the causes unto Elohim:
Exo 18:20 And you shall teach them ordinances and laws, and shall show them the way wherein they must walk, and the work that they must do.
Exo 18:21 Moreover you shall provide out of all the people able men, such as fear Elohim, men of truth, hating covetousness; and place such over them, to be rulers of thousands, and rulers of hundreds, rulers of fifties, and rulers of tens:
Exo 18:22 And let them judge the people at all seasons: and it shall be, that every great matter they shall bring unto you, but every small matter they shall judge: so shall it be easier for yourself, and they shall bear the burden with you.
Exo 18:23 If you shall do this thing, and Elohim command you so, then you shall be able to endure, and all this people shall also go to their place in peace.
Reader 3 (Evening Portion)
Exo 18:24 So Moshe hearkened to the voice of his father in law, and did all that he had said.
Exo 18:25 And Moshe chose able men out of all Yisra'el, and made them heads over the people, rulers of thousands, rulers of hundreds, rulers of fifties, and rulers of tens.
(Morning Portion)
Exo 18:26 And they judged the people at all seasons: the hard causes they brought unto Moshe, but every small matter they judged themselves.
Exo 18:27 And Moshe let his father in law depart; and he went his way into his own land.
Reader 4 (Evening Portion)
Exo 19:1 In the third month, when the children of Yisra'el were gone forth out of the land of Egypt, the same day came they into the wilderness of Sinai.
Exo 19:2 For they were departed from Refidim, and were come to the desert of Sinai, and had pitched in the wilderness; and there Yisra'el camped before the mount.
(Morning Portion)
Exo 19:3 And Moshe went up unto Elohim, and YHWH called unto him out of the mountain, saying, Thus shall you say to the house of Ya'akov, and tell the children of Yisra'el;
Exo 19:4 You have seen what I did unto the Egyptians, and how I bore you on eagles' wings, and brought you unto myself.
Exo 19:5 Now therefore, if you will obey my voice indeed, and keep my covenant, then you shall be a peculiar treasure unto me above all people: for all the earth is mine:
Exo 19:6 And you shall be unto me a kingdom of priests, and an holy nation. These are the words which you shall speak unto the children of Yisra'el.
Reader 5 (Evening Portion)
Exo 19:7 And Moshe came and called for the elders of the people, and laid before their faces all these words which YHWH commanded him.
Exo 19:8 And all the people answered together, and said, All that YHWH has spoken we will do. And Moshe returned the words of the people unto YHWH.
Exo 19:9 And YHWH said unto Moshe, Lo, I come unto you in a thick cloud, that the people may hear when I speak with you, and believe you for ever. And Moshe told the words of the people unto YHWH.
Exo 19:10 And YHWH said unto Moshe, Go unto the people, and sanctify them to day and tomorrow, and let them wash their clothes,
Exo 19:11 And be ready against the third day: for the third day YHWH will come down in the sight of all the people upon mount Sinai.
Exo 19:12 And you shall set bounds unto the people round about, saying, Take heed to yourselves, that you go not up into the mount, or touch the border of it: whosoever touches the mount shall be surely put to death:
Exo 19:13 There shall not an hand touch it, but he shall surely be stoned, or shot through; whether it be beast or man, it shall not live: when the trumpet sounds long, they shall come up to the mount.
Exo 19:14 And Moshe went down from the mount unto the people, and sanctified the people; and they washed their clothes.
Exo 19:15 And he said unto the people, Be ready against the third day: come not at your wives.
(Morning Portion)
Exo 19:16 And it came to pass on the third day in the morning, that there were thunders and lightnings, and a thick cloud upon the mount, and the voice of the shofar exceeding loud; so that all the people that was in the camp trembled.
Exo 19:17 And Moshe brought forth the people out of the camp to meet with Elohim; and they stood at the nether part of the mount.
Exo 19:18 And mount Sinai was altogether on a smoke, because YHWH descended upon it in fire: and the smoke thereof ascended as the smoke of a furnace, and the whole mount quaked greatly.
Exo 19:19 And when the voice of the trumpet sounded long, and waxed louder and louder, Moshe spoke, and Elohim answered him by a voice.
Reader 6 (Evening Portion)
Exo 19:20 And YHWH came down upon mount Sinai, on the top of the mount: and YHWH called Moshe up to the top of the mount; and Moshe went up.
Exo 19:21 And YHWH said unto Moshe, Go down, charge the people, lest they break through unto YHWH to gaze, and many of them perish.
Exo 19:22 And let the priests also, which come near to YHWH, sanctify themselves, lest YHWH break forth upon them.
Exo 19:23 And Moshe said unto YHWH, The people cannot come up to mount Sinai: for you charged us, saying, Set bounds about the mount, and sanctify it.
Exo 19:24 And YHWH said unto him, Away, get you down, and you shall come up, you, and Aharon with you: but let not the priests and the people break through to come up unto YHWH, lest he break forth upon them.
Exo 19:25 So Moshe went down unto the people, and spoke unto them.
Exo 20:1 And Elohim spoke all these words, saying,
Exo 20:2 I am YHWH your Elohim, which have brought you out of the land of Egypt, out of the house of bondage.
Exo 20:3 You shall have no other elohim before me.
Exo 20:4 You shall not make unto you any graven image, or any likeness of any thing that is in heaven above, or that is in the earth beneath, or that is in the water under the earth:
Exo 20:5 You shall not bow down yourself to them, nor serve them: for I YHWH your Elohim am a jealous Elohim, visiting the lawlessness of the fathers upon the children unto the third and fourth generation of them that hate me;
Exo 20:6 And showing mercy unto thousands of them that love me, and keep my commandments.
Exo 20:7 You shall not take the name of YHWH your Elohim in vain; for YHWH will not hold him guiltless that takes his name in vain.
Exo 20:8 Remember the sabbath day, to keep it holy.
Exo 20:9 Six days shall you labor, and do all your work:
Exo 20:10 But the seventh day is the sabbath of YHWH your Elohim: in it you shall not do any work, you, nor your son, nor your daughter, your manservant, nor your maidservant, nor your cattle, nor your stranger that is within your gates:
Exo 20:11 For in six days YHWH made heaven and earth, the sea, and all that in them is, and rested the seventh day: wherefore YHWH blessed the sabbath day, and hallowed it.
Exo 20:12 Honor your father and your mother: that your days may be long upon the land which YHWH thy Elohim gives you.
Reader 7 (6th Day Morning Portion)
Exo 20:13 You shall not murder.
Exo 20:14 You shall not commit adultery.
Exo 20:15 You shalt not steal.
Exo 20:16 You shalt not bear false witness against your neighbour.
Exo 20:17 You shall not covet your neighbor's house, you shall not covet your neighbor's wife, nor his manservant, nor his maidservant, nor his ox, nor his donkey, nor any thing that is your neighbor's.
Exo 20:18 And all the people saw the thunderings, and the lightnings, and the noise of the shofar, and the mountain smoking: and when the people saw it, they removed, and stood afar off.
Exo 20:19 And they said unto Moshe, Speak you with us, and we will hear: but let not Elohim speak with us, lest we die.
Exo 20:20 And Moshe said unto the people, Fear not: for Elohim is come to prove you, and that his fear may be before your faces, that you sin not.
Exo 20:21 And the people stood afar off, and Moshe drew near unto the thick darkness where Elohim was.
Exo 20:22 And YHWH said unto Moshe, Thus you shall say unto the children of Yisra'el, You have seen that I have talked with you from heaven.
Exo 20:23 You shall not make with me elohim of silver, neither shall you make unto you elohim of gold.
Exo 20:24 An altar of earth you shall make unto me, and shall sacrifice thereon your burnt offerings, and your peace offerings, your sheep, and your oxen in all places where I record my name I will come unto you, and I will bless you.
Exo 20:25 And if you will make me an altar of stone, you shall not build it of hewn stone: for if you lift up your tool upon it, you have polluted it.
Exo 20:26 Neither shall you go up by steps unto mine altar, that your nakedness be not discovered thereon.
Haftarah (Shabbat Evening Portion)
Isa 6:1 In the year that king Uzziyahu died I saw also Adonai sitting upon a throne, high and lifted up, and his train filled the temple.
Isa 6:2 Above it stood the serafim: each one had six wings; with two he covered his face, and with two he covered his feet, and with two he did fly.
Isa 6:3 And one cried unto another, and said, Holy, holy, holy, is YHWH Tsebeoth: the whole earth is full of his glory.
Isa 6:4 And the posts of the door moved at the voice of him that cried, and the house was filled with smoke.
Isa 6:5 Then said I, Woe is me! for I am undone; because I am a man of unclean lips, and I dwell in the midst of a people of unclean lips: for my eyes have seen the King, YHWH Tsebeoth.
Isa 6:6 Then flew one of the serafim unto me, having a live coal in his hand, which he had taken with the tongs from off the altar:
Isa 6:7 And he laid it upon my mouth, and said, Lo, this hath touched your lips; and your lawlessness is taken away, and your sin purged.
Isa 6:8 Also I heard the voice of Adonai, saying, Whom shall I send, and who will go for us? Then said I, Here am I; send me.
Isa 6:9 And he said, Go, and tell this people, Hear you indeed, but understand not; and see you indeed, but perceive not.
Isa 6:10 Make the heart of this people fat, and make their ears heavy, and shut their eyes; lest they see with their eyes, and hear with their ears, and understand with their heart, and convert, and be healed.
Isa 6:11 Then said I, Adonai, how long? And he answered, Until the cities be wasted without inhabitant, and the houses without man, and the land be utterly desolate,
Isa 6:12 And YHWH have removed men far away, and there be a great forsaking in the midst of the land.
Isa 6:13 But yet in it shall be a tenth, and it shall return, and shall be eaten: as a teil tree, and as an oak, whose substance is in them, when they cast their leaves: so the holy seed shall be the substance thereof.
Isa 7:1 And it came to pass in the days of Achaz the son of Yotam, the son of Uzziyahu, king of Yahudah, that Retzin the king of Syria, and Pekach the son of Remalyahu, king of Yisrael, went up toward Yahrushalayim to war against it, but could not prevail against it.
Isa 7:2 And it was told the house of David, saying, Syria is confederate with Efrayim. And his heart was moved, and the heart of his people, as the trees of the wood are moved with the wind.
Isa 7:3 Then said YHWH unto Yeshaiyahu, Go forth now to meet Achaz, you, and She'ar-Yashuv your son, at the end of the conduit of the upper pool in the highway of the fuller's field;
Isa 7:4 And say unto him, Take heed, and be quiet; fear not, neither be fainthearted for the two tails of these smoking firebrands, for the fierce anger of Retzin with Syria, and of the son of Remalyahu.
Isa 7:5 Because Syria, Efrayim, and the son of Remalyahu, have taken evil counsel against you, saying,
Isa 7:6 Let us go up against Yahudah, and vex it, and let us make a breach therein for us, and set a king in the midst of it, even the son of Tav'el:
Isa 9:6 For unto us a child is born, unto us a son is given: and the government shall be upon his shoulder: and his name shall be called Wonderful, Counsellor, The mighty Elohim, The everlasting Father, The Prince of Peace.
Isa 9:7 Of the increase of his government and peace there shall be no end, upon the throne of David, and upon his kingdom, to order it, and to establish it with judgment and with justice from henceforth even for ever. The zeal of YHWH Tsebeoth will perform this.
